Man on probation in pot house incident, arrested again
September 19, 2007

TORRINGTON, Conn. --A man who was on probation on drug charges after painting large pictures of marijuana leaves on his Winsted home has been arrested on drug charges at his new home in Torrington.

Christopher Seekins, 27, was arrested Monday after a strong odor in his apartment sparked the curiosity of probation officers there for a routine visit, police said.

Police said they seized 58 plants from a bedroom closet Monday. The plants were growing under lights rotated by a motorized rail system, according to court records.

Police also allegedly found 1.84 pounds of marijuana drying inside a refrigerator covered with a blanket. In Seekins' basement, more growing equipment was found, including 24 bags of potting soil, grow lamps and scales, according to court records.

The former Winsted resident got a two-year suspended sentence in 2006 after pleading guilty to a single count of cultivation of marijuana. Seekins was told to stay out of trouble.

Two years ago Winsted police found 100 thriving plants in his house on High Street. Seekins said he was a botanist performing research.

Seekins drew fire from town officials when he spray painted bright green marijuana leaves with the word "hemp" beneath them on his white home visible from the town's busy Main Street.

Seekins told Bantam Superior Court Judge Paul Matasavage at an arraignment hearing Tuesday he intended to represent himself again.

Matasavage set bond at $100,000 and scheduled him to return to court Oct. 10.
